Bihar will not have to return money taken for flood relief: Mukherjee
New Delhi, July 10 (ANI): Union Finance Minister Pranb Mukherjee today said the Bihar Government will not have to return the Rs 1,000 crore given to it by the Centre, as part of the relief fund for Kosi flood victims.
Mukherjee made this announcement during zero Hour when Janata Dal (United) President Sharad Yadav attacked the Centre for sending a missive to the state government that the amount given for flood relief would have to be recovered.
Yadav expressed hi anguish over the money was being recovered despite Prime Minister Manmohan Singh declaring Kosi floods as a national calamity.
Yadav said the centre is mum even after Prime Minister Manmohan Singh's assurance to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ar that the matter will be looked into.
Responding to the matter Mukherjee said the letter had been sent as part of a technical requirement. But Union government assures that there is no question of returning or recovering the money from Bihar. The government has taken s decision in the matter keeping in view the magnitude of the tragedy.
